St George's Day is traditionally observed on 23 April each year, though Christian churches sometimes move or "transfer" the observance to nearby dates around Easter. In 2025, for example, the Church of England and the Catholic Church held St George's Day celebrations on Monday, 28 April, instead of 23 April. Public coverage and event listings for the year often show multiple celebrations around late April, depending on local schedules and Easter timing. Saint George’s Day is widely observed across England every 23 April. It is not a bank holiday, but its recognition as an important cultural day is growing and many people believe it should be a holiday just as St. Andrew’s Day in Scotland and St. Patrick’s Day in Ireland are.
